AAIP 67 Points
The Alberta Express Entry Stream awards points for age, official language ability, education, work experience, arranged employment, and adaptability. You must score at least 67 points to be eligible.
Total maximum: 100 points
| Factor | Maximum Points Awarded |
|---|---|
| Language Skills | 28 |
| Education | 25 |
| Work Experience | 15 |
| Age | 12 |
| Arranged Employment | 10 |
| Adaptability | 10 |
Maximum 12 points
| Age (years) | Points Awarded |
|---|---|
| Under 18 | 0 |
| 18-35 | 12 |
| 36 | 11 |
| 37 | 10 |
| 38 | 9 |
| 39 | 8 |
| 40 | 7 |
| 41 | 6 |
| 42 | 5 |
| 43 | 4 |
| 44 | 3 |
| 45 | 2 |
| 46 | 1 |
| 47 and older | 0 |
Maximum 28 points. First Official Language: up to 24, Second: up to 4.
| CLB Level | Speaking | Reading | Listening | Writing |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 9 or higher | 6 | 6 | 6 | 6 |
| 8 | 5 | 5 | 5 | 5 |
| 7 | 4 | 4 | 4 | 4 |
| Below 7 | Not eligible | Not eligible | Not eligible | Not eligible |
Maximum 4 points
| CLB Level | Points Awarded |
|---|---|
| At least CLB 5 in all four abilities | 4 |
| CLB 4 or less in any of the four abilities | 0 |
Maximum 25 points
| Education Level | Points Awarded |
|---|---|
| University degree at Doctoral (Ph.D.) level or equal | 25 |
| University degree at Master's level or equal OR University level entry-to-practice professional degree (or equal) | 23 |
| Two or more Canadian post-secondary degrees/diplomas (one must be at least 3 years) | 22 |
| Canadian post-secondary degree/diploma (3+ years) | 21 |
| Canadian post-secondary degree/diploma (2 years) | 19 |
| Canadian post-secondary degree/diploma (1 year) | 15 |
| Canadian high school diploma or equal | 5 |
Maximum 15 points
| Experience (Years) | Points Awarded |
|---|---|
| 1 | 9 |
| 2-3 | 11 |
| 4-5 | 13 |
| 6 or more | 15 |
Maximum 10 points. Applies to various LMIA and work permit scenarios.
| Applicant Scenario | Points Awarded |
|---|---|
| LMIA-based work permit and skilled job (NOC 0, A, or B), valid at PR application, employer makes full-time offer (must still have valid permit at PR issuance) | 10 |
| LMIA-exempt work permit or work permit under provincial agreement, valid at PR application, employer makes full-time job offer (must still have valid permit at PR issuance) | 10 |
| No work permit/not authorized, but job offer + positive LMIA | 10 |
| Other valid permit/authorization + job offer + positive LMIA | 10 |
Maximum 10 points. Several factors can each award 5 or 10 points.
| Factor | Points Awarded |
|---|---|
| PA previous work in Canada (min 1 year in skilled occupation NOC TEER Category 0, 1, or 2) | 10 |
| Relatives in Canada 18+ years and citizen or PR | 5 |
| Accompanying spouse/partner's official language (CLB/NCLC 4) | 5 |
| A previous study in Canada | 5 |
| A previous study in Canada accompanying spouse/partner | 5 |
| Previous work in Canada accompanying spouse/partner | 5 |
| Arranged employment in Canada | 5 |
| Relative in Canada 18+ years | 5 |
| Language ability CLB 4 or above accompanying spouse/partner (IELTS 4.0/4.5/3.5/4.0) | 5 |
